Technical Overview of the ASTM F2281 Standard

The ASTM F2281 specification establishes rigorous requirements for the physical and mechanical properties and chemical composition of fasteners, including studs, hex head bolts, and screws with diameters starting from 1/4 inch. These components are engineered by EV Group China for operation in extreme temperature conditions reaching 982 ºC (1800 ºF), where heat resistance and geometric stability of the product are critical.

The ASTM F2281 nomenclature includes a wide range of high-alloy steels, allowing for the selection of optimal solutions for operation in aggressive corrosive environments and under high thermal loads. When designing and ordering, it should be noted that the base unit of measurement in this standard is the inch. Values provided in the SI system are for reference purposes and are intended to simplify integration into international technical projects.
